Appropriate Preposition:

  • Favour with ( অনুগত করা ) Would you favour me with an early reply?
  • Opposite to ( বিপরীত ) Your idea is opposite to mine.
  • Differ in ( ভিন্ন মত হওয়া (মতামত) ) They differ in their opinions.
  • Consist of ( গঠিত হওয়া ) This class consists of fifty boys and thirty girls.
  • Dull at ( কাঁচা ) He is dull at Physics.
  • Die by ( মারা যাওয়া (বিষ) ) He died by poison.

Idioms:

  • Bird of a feather ( এক রকম স্বভাবের লোক ) Birds of a feather flock together.
  • Head and ears ( সম্পূর্ণরূপে ) He is over head and ears in debt.
  • By leaps and bounds ( অতি দ্রুতগতিতে ) The population of Bangladesh is increasing by leaps and bounds.
  • In no time ( শীঘ্র ) He will finish the work in no time.
  • Cut to the quick ( মর্মাহত হওয়া ) I was cut to the quick by his words.
  • Out of the wood ( বিপদমুক্ত ) He is not yet out of the wood.
